本書(shū)內(nèi)容主要為第八屆研討會(huì)的部分論文和摘要,內(nèi)容豐富,包括資源和環(huán)境領(lǐng)域的稀土地質(zhì)礦山、采礦選礦、分離冶煉、循環(huán)利用和環(huán)境保護(hù),以及稀土物理化學(xué)和稀土應(yīng)用領(lǐng)域的永磁、發(fā)光、催化、儲(chǔ)氫、超導(dǎo)、玻璃陶瓷、納米材料等,反映了相關(guān)領(lǐng)域的最新科研動(dòng)態(tài)。
